Reports naming the air-bag system — deployment behaviour, inflators, sensors and warning lights. Every record below is an owner-reported complaint about the 2004 Nissan Sentra submitted to NHTSA — not a confirmed defect, not a recall and not a manufacturer bulletin. 32 reports on file name it.
Complaints are reports submitted by owners and drivers to NHTSA. They are not verified and do not establish that a defect exists.

TL* THE CONTACT OWNS A 2004 NISSAN SENTRA. WHILE THE DRIVER WAS MAKING A LEFT TURN, ANOTHER VEHICLE CRASHED INTO THE PASSENGER SIDE OF THE CONTACT'S VEHICLE. THE PASSENGER SIDE AIR BAG DEPLOYED, BUT NOT THE DRIVER'S SIDE AIR BAG. THE DRIVER SUSTAINED UPPER TORSO INJURIES, HEAD TRAUMA, AND PELVIC FRACTURES AND DIED DUE TO THE INJURIES. MEDICAL ATTENTION WAS REQUIRED. A POLICE REPORT WAS FILED. THE DEALER WAS NOT CONTACTED. THE VIN WAS INCLUDED IN NHTSA CAMPAIGN NUMBER: 15V287000 (AIR BAGS). THE MANUFACTURER WAS NOT NOTIFIED OF THE FAILURE. THE VEHICLE WAS TOWED TO A POLICE IMPOUND LOT. THE FAILURE MILEAGE WAS UNKNOWN. **BF..*BF..*BF *TR

TL* THE CONTACT OWNS A 2004 NISSAN SENTRA. WHILE DRIVING 25 MPH, ANOTHER VEHICLE FAILED TO YIELD AND CRASHED INTO THE FRONT OF THE CONTACT'S VEHICLE. THE AIR BAGS FAILED TO DEPLOY. THE CONTACT SUSTAINED RIB INJURIES THAT REQUIRED MEDICAL ATTENTION. A POLICE REPORT WAS FILED. THE VEHICLE WAS NOT DIAGNOSED OR REPAIRED. ON ANOTHER OCCASION, WHILE AT A STOP LIGHT, ANOTHER VEHICLE CRASHED INTO THE REAR OF THE CONTACT'S VEHICLE. THE AIR BAGS FAILED TO DEPLOY. THE CONTACT DID NOT SUSTAIN ANY INJURIES, BUT RECEIVED MEDICAL ATTENTION. A POLICE REPORT WAS FILED. THE VEHICLE WAS NOT DIAGNOSED OR REPAIRED. THE VIN WAS INCLUDED IN NHTSA CAMPAIGN NUMBER: 15V287000 (AIR BAGS). THE MANUFACTURER WAS NOT NOTIFIED. THE FAILURE MILEAGE WAS UNKNOWN.
